Transaction 505e6bcb2cd123a16c8ad8e94e57fda203f2364d47fb78cdb2a23def7546b546

1 Input
2 Outputs
  • 505e6bcb2cd123a16c8ad8e94e57fda203f2364d47fb78cdb2a23def7546b546:0
  • value  3179973
    address  39otTyf337nCQ5oyLeBdX11NxD3NpUb9YX
  • 505e6bcb2cd123a16c8ad8e94e57fda203f2364d47fb78cdb2a23def7546b546:1
  • value  17124176
    address  1HT11kntosCTtxUDQz2PHvm9HQwVR3aAei